Uniform Tire Quality Grading Standards
A uniform standard to grade the quality of tires with regards to tread quality, tire traction and temperature characteristics. Ratings are determined by tire manufacturers using U.S.
government testing procedures. The ratings are molded into the sidewall of the tire.
